    摘要: A service life determining system for determining the service life of an image bearing member or a magazine containing an image bearing member removably mounted on a main body of a copying apparatus and the like by counting the number of times of use or a period of time of use, including a resettable counter mounted on the main body of the copying apparatus for counting the number of times or the period of time the image bearing member is used and indicating the result, counter resetting means mounted on the image bearing member or the magazine containing the image bearing member for resetting the counter, and an actuator for actuating the counter resetting means. The actuator for the counter resetting means is operative to actuate the counter resetting means when a new image bearing member is mounted on the main body of the copying apparatus and destroyed when the new image bearing member or the magazine containing the new image bearing member has been set in a predetermined position after the counter resetting means is actuated, whereby the actuator is rendered in capable of actuating the counter resetting means again.

    摘要: A cork knife cleaning apparatus for cigarette filter attaching machine in a cork paper cutting apparatus is provided. The apparatus has a rotating drum which has cork knives projecting from the circumference of the same, receiving drum arranged to work with the rotating drum whereby a continuous tape of cork paper applied with paste on one side is cut into a desired length by pressing a cork knife against the tape paper, and has a cork knife cleaning apparatus comprising rotating brushes to clean the blades of the cork knives, an oil injecting nozzle having a plurality of oil injecting ports over the entire width of the nozzle, an oil supply system connected to the oil injecting nozzle, and a compressed air supply system connected to the oil injecting system, whereby the rotating brushes are uniformly sprayed with atomized oil. Therefore, the blades of cork knives can be clean, removing foreign substances which attach to as a result of cutting the pasted cork paper, and this maintains the cutting performance of the knives for long period time.

    摘要: An in-wheel motor driving device in which a motor section A and a wheel hub bearing section C are connected coaxially in series via a speed reducer section B, whereby an axial dimension of the in-wheel motor driving device is reduced to provide a large inside space of a vehicle as well as an increase in freedom of routing a power supply wires. A terminal box for the power supply wires which supply power to the motor section A is disposed on the outer circumferential side surface of the housing which holds the motor section A. The power supply wires are routed out of the terminal box to an inboard side and are anchored by a power supply wire holder which extends perpendicularly to an axial centerline of the housing.

    摘要: An object of the present invention is to achieve improvements in the rotational accuracy of the input shaft and the durability of the bearings, and suppression of rotational noise, by improving the support structure of the input shaft of the speed reduction unit. Provided is a drive device for an electric vehicle, including: an electric motor; a speed reduction unit including an input shaft driven by output of the electric motor; and a hub unit rotationally driven by an output member of the speed reduction unit, wherein the input shaft of the speed reduction unit is supported by bearings provided at two locations in an axial direction, the drive device for an electric vehicle being configured such that the bearings at the two locations are attached together to the output member.

    摘要: An air intake device for an engine is provided that includes a throttle body (1), a throttle valve (5) that has a valve shaft (5a) rotatably supported on the throttle body (1), a throttle drum (8) connected to one end of the throttle valve (5), a throttle sensor (51) connected to the other end of the valve shaft (5a), a bypass (20) bypassing the throttle valve (5), and a bypass valve (25) that opens and closes the bypass (20), a bearing boss (3) supporting one end part, on the throttle drum (8) side, of the valve shaft (5a) being integrally and projecting provided on one side face of the throttle body (1), wherein the bypass (20) is formed so as to surround the bearing boss (3). This enables the air intake device for an engine to be made compact in spite of the bypass being present.

    摘要: An in-wheel motor drive device 21 includes: a motor portion A; a speed reduction portion B that reduces the speed of rotation of the motor portion A to output the rotation having the reduced speed to an output shaft 28; and a wheel hub 32 coupled to the output shaft 28. The speed reduction portion B has a cylindrical casing-side member 45 that extends from one axial end to the other axial end of the speed reduction portion and that has both one end and the other end formed integrally, the output shaft 28 that is inserted through an inner space region of the casing-side member, and two output-shaft bearings 38a, 38b that are respectively provided on an inner periphery at both ends 45f of the casing-side member to rotatably support the output shaft 28.
